What questions do IDPs ask about the Center for Free Secondary Legal Aid?

From the first days of the war, the specialists of the local Chervonohrad Center for Free Secondary Legal Aid reformatted their work, taking into account the realities of the time. Three employees are on duty at the legal aid hotline.

Others provide outlets for free legal aid in compact settlements of internally displaced persons. During this period, specialists provided more than 500 services. The most relevant for this category of citizens are the issues of gaining status, recovery of lost documents, payment of pensions, preservation of jobs, compensation for free housing, social benefits for internally displaced persons, border crossing.

Therefore, appeals are already registered for the provision of secondary legal aid (lawyer’s services) – to establish the fact of birth in the temporarily occupied territory, deprivation of parental rights of a man – a citizen of Russia, recovery of alimony and more. A new direction for the Center was the work related to documenting the facts of Russia’s military aggression, which is carried out with the direct consent of eyewitnesses. Currently 4 cases are being processed.
